This 1978 Leyland Mini 1000 is a rare find due to its originality and low mileage (48,773 miles). It features a 998cc engine, manual gearbox, and a cream interior. The car has been well-maintained by only three owners, comes with a comprehensive history file, and is estimated to sell between £7,000 - £9,000.

The car is described as being in highly original condition with low mileage for its age. The exterior has some minor imperfections like overspray, but the paint has been ceramic coated. The interior is mostly original, with a period-correct upgrade. Mechanically, the engine is sound, and the car has been serviced with a new radiator and rust proofing. The history file is extensive, including original sales documents and service records. While not perfect, its originality and care place it in very good condition.

Alec Issigonis was a genuine free thinker – only a mind unshackled from convention could come up with the Mini in 1959.

It wasn’t the first front wheel drive car, it wasn’t the first small car, and it wasn’t even the first with an engine placed east-west across the engine bay.

What makes it unique is a combination of all these things, plus more besides.

And above all, apart from being eminently practical, it was as cute as a cart load of monkeys.

Colour choice is entirely subjective, but we think bright yellow paintwork just adds to that inherent cuteness.

However, this 1978 Mini has a lot more going for it than simply being highly visually appealing – it’s a lot more than just a pretty face.

During its 46 year life this iconic machine has covered just 48,733 miles, and there’s a huge history file with the car, including the original sales documents.
